Abstract
The adhesion of self-bonding, low modulus, one package, room temperature vulcanizable silicone compositions to a variety of substrates is effectively promoted by incorporating in the silicone composition, before curing, a small effective amount of an adhesion promoting composition comprising predominantly at least one diorganocyclopolysiloxane compound of the formula: ##STR1## wherein R1 may be C1 -C6 alkyl, C1 -C6 gamma-trihaloalkyl or phenyl; R2 is alkylene of from 2 to 6 carbon atoms; R3, R4 and R5 are, independently, C1 -C6 alkyl or C2 -C6 alkanoyl; and n is either 3 or 4.

4. A process for the preparation of diorganocyclopolysiloxane of the formula:
- ##STR44## wherein R1 is C1 -C6 alkyl, C1 -C6 gamma-trihaloalkyl or phenyl;
R2 is alkylene of from 2 to 6 carbon atoms;
R3, R4 and R5 are, independently, C1 -C6 alkyl or C2 -C6 alkanoyl and n is either 3 or 4, said process comprising;(a) dissolving an alkylhydrogencyclopolysiloxane of the formula;
##STR45## wherein R1 and n are as defined above, in an aromatic organic solvent to form an approximately 20% by weight solution;(b) heating said solution to reflux; (c) adding a minor effective amount of a platinum silicone complex catalyst; (d) thereafter adding a vinyl or a vinyl C2 -C4 alkyl-trialkoxy or triacyloxysilane of the formula;
##STR46## wherein R2 is a vinyl or CH2 ═
CH--(CH2)m group where m has a value of 1 to 4 inclusive and R3, R4 and R5 are as defined above in an amount sufficient to provide a slight excess of the amount needed to effect a vinyl addition reaction at each Si--H bond of said alkylhydrogencyclopolysiloxane;(e) allowing the reaction therebetween to continue until substantially complete; and (f) finally, removing said aromatic organic solvent to leave the diorganocyclopolysiloxane product. - View Dependent Claims (5, 6, 7, 8, 11, 12)

9. An article of manufacture comprising a plurality of pieces, each piece having at least a part of a surface portion in close proximity to another piece, and having an adhesive joint therebetween, said adhesive joint comprising a low modulus, rubbery, moisture cured composition comprising:
-
(a) a silanol or polyalkoxy chain-stopped diorganopolysiloxane; (b) a silane or polysilane crosslinker therefor; (c) a catalyst capable of promoting the reactions between (a) and (b); and (d) a small, effective, adhesion promoting amount of a composition comprising at least one compound of the formula;
##STR47## wherein R1 is C1 -C6 alkyl, C1 -C6 gamma-trihaloalkyl or phenyl;
R2 is alkylene of from 2 to 6 carbon atoms;
R3, R4 and R5 are, independently, C1 -C6 alkyl or C2 -C6 alkanoyl and n is 3 or 4.

10. A method of bonding a plurality of articles comprising:
-
(a) providing a plurality of articles; (b) applying a layer of moisture-curable, adhesive joint forming composition to at least a portion of a surface of at least one of the articles; (c) bringing at least two surfaces of at least two of said articles into proximity so as to complete formation of a moisture curable adhesive joint therebetween; and (d) exposing the article of step (c) to moisture until the adhesive joint forming composition has cured to a firmly adhered rubbery material, said moisture curable adhesive joint forming composition comprising; (i) a silanol or polyalkoxy chain-stopped polydiorganosiloxane; (ii) a silane or polysilane crosslinker therefor; (iii) a catalyst capable of promoting the reactions between (i) and (ii); and (iv) a small, effective, adhesion promoting amount of a composition comprising at least one diorganocyclopolysiloxane compound of the formula;
##STR48## wherein R1 is C1 -C6 alkyl, C1 -C6 gamma trihaloalkyl or phenyl;
R2 is alkylene of from 2 to 6 carbon atoms;
R3, R4 and R5 are, independently C1 -C6 alkyl or C2 -C6 alkanoyl and n is 3 or 4.
